This is a great achievement. The Object ID still is a major tool in the
fight against Illicit Traffic. It is good that it is now under ICOM's
stewardship. Having it available in so many languages shows ICOM's
commitment to the cause and the efforts to be a truly global organisation.

> We are pleased to inform you that the Object ID checklist is now available
> in 11 different languages:
> Arabic, Chinese, Czech, English, French, German, Hungarian, Italian, Korean,
> Russian,  Spanish.
> Please check : 
> 
> http://icom.museum/object-id/checklist.html 
> 
> 
> We invite all National Committees to translate the Object ID checklist in
> their language and encourage the widest possible dissemination of this check
> list.
